Step 1/7

Wash and chop the bell pepper, tomato, avocado and spring onions.

Step 2/7

Also wash the coriander and parsley and pick off the leaves.

Step 3/7

Drain the corn and kidney beans and put everything in a large bowl.

Step 4/7

Chop the chili and garlic for the dressing and add the lime juice, olive oil, agave syrup and cumin. Season to taste with salt and pepper.

Step 5/7

Mix the dressing with the salad and serve with a dollop of crème fraîche.

Step 6/7

Add a little bean and pea mix as a crunchy topping to each plate.
